What color is 86FFC4?

The RGB color code for color number #86FFC4 is RGB(134, 255, 196). In the RGB color model, #86FFC4 has a red value of 134, a green value of 255, and a blue value of 196.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 47.5%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 23.1% yellow, and 0.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 150.7° (degrees), 100.0 % saturation, and 76.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#86FFC4 has a hue of 150.7° (degrees), 47.5 % saturation and 100.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 86FFC4?

Color code 86FFC4 has an LRV of nearly 81. By LRV value, it is a whitish color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
